Investigation Summary

Investigation Nr: 146548.015
Event: 05/23/2022
Employee is electrocuted and falls from ladder

At 10:30 a.m. on May 23, 2022, an employee and a coworker were replacing two industrial lights with LED lights which were positioned approximately ten feet above the concrete floor. Rather than use the lockout/tagout procedures mandated by the company and the facility's protocol, the employees chose to bypass the procedures and just turn off breakers. However, the employees were not able to identify the correct breakers so the employee continued to work while the coworker took a smoke break. While the employee was wiring the LED industrial light on a ten foot Rock River ladder, he made contact with live electrical part, was electrocuted, fell from the ladder and was pronounced dead at the scene.
